Lotte Construction is launching its first ‘Lotte Castle’ apartment in Daejeon.
On the 14th, Lotte Construction opened the model house for ‘Daejeon Lotte Castle The First’ and officially began the subscription schedule. The complex is located at 394, Gao-dong, Dong-gu, Daejeon.
The complex consists of 10 buildings, ranging from 2 basement floors to 33 above-ground floors, with a total of 952 households. Among them, 394 units will be sold to the general public. The supply area and number of units are divided into 59㎡ (Type A 173 units, Type B 180 units, Type C 18 units) and 74㎡ Type B 23 units.
The complex is conveniently located along Daejeon-ro and Daejeong-ro, making it easy to access the city center. It is close to the Tongyeong-Daejeon Expressway Panam IC and Nam Daejeon IC. Daejeon Station is also nearby, providing access to KTX, SRT, and Subway Line 1. In 2028, Subway Line 2 (tram) will run next to the complex. Bomunsan and Sikjangsan mountains are nearby, and the pedestrian path of Daejeoncheon Citizen Suspension Park is directly connected in front of the complex.
The complex will feature a sky lounge and sky guest house, which are being introduced for the first time in the region. It will also include a study room, book cafe, indoor golf club, and kids’ room.
Some units are designed with a 4-bay layout, dressing room, and alpha room to maximize space usage. A bay refers to a space with windows. A 4-bay layout means the living room and three bedrooms are arranged side by side facing the front balcony.
Subscriptions start with special supply on the 19th, followed by first priority on the 20th, and second priority general supply on the 21st. Winners will be announced on the 27th. Contracts will be signed from the 10th to the 12th of next month. To apply for first priority, applicants must have a subscription savings account for more than six months and meet the deposit requirements. Only residents of Daejeon, Sejong, and Chungnam are eligible.
A Lotte Construction official said, "We will enhance residents’ satisfaction by combining the Lotte Castle brand with a pleasant living environment and premium facilities." Move-in is scheduled for November 2027.
